Gene symbol: Cldn2

Also known as: RGD1560247

Organism: Rattus norvegicus

Summary: Predicted to enable identical protein binding activity. Predicted to be involved in bicellular tight junction assembly and calcium-independent cell-cell adhesion via plasma membrane cell-adhesion molecules. Predicted to be located in cell-cell junction. Predicted to be active in bicellular tight junction and plasma membrane. Orthologous to human CLDN2 (claudin 2). [provided by Alliance of Genome Resources, Apr 2022]
